Why Moss Removal is Essential

Moss may seem harmless, but it can cause significant damage to your driveway. Here are some reasons why moss removal is important:

  • Safety Hazards: Moss makes surfaces slippery, increasing the risk of accidents.
  • Structural Damage: Over time, moss can erode driveway materials, leading to cracks and other damage.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: A moss-covered driveway detracts from the beauty of your home.

Addressing moss promptly ensures your driveway remains safe, durable, and visually appealing.

Additionally, removing moss can prevent other issues, such as weed growth, which thrives in the same damp environments.

Common Causes of Moss Growth

Moss thrives in shady, moist environments with little sunlight. Driveways that are surrounded by trees or structures that block sunlight are more susceptible to moss growth.

Poor drainage and compacted surfaces also contribute to the ideal conditions for moss to flourish. Addressing these underlying issues can help prevent future moss problems.

Effective Moss Removal Techniques

There are various methods to remove moss from your driveway. Below are some of the most effective techniques:

  1. Manual Removal: Scrubbing the driveway with a stiff brush to physically remove moss.
  2. Pressure Washing: Using a pressure washer to blast away moss and clean the surface.
  3. Chemical Treatments: Applying moss-killing chemicals that eliminate moss without damaging the driveway.
  4. Natural Remedies: Utilizing environmentally friendly solutions like vinegar or baking soda.

Each method has its pros and cons, and often a combination of techniques yields the best results.

For large or stubborn moss infestations, professional services may be the most effective and time-efficient solution.

Regular maintenance after removal is crucial to prevent moss from returning.

Preventing Future Moss Growth

After successfully removing moss, taking steps to prevent its return is essential. Here are some preventive measures:

  • Improve Drainage: Ensure water does not pool on your driveway by addressing drainage issues.
  • Increase Sunlight Exposure: Trim overhanging branches to allow more sunlight to reach the driveway.
  • Use Sealants: Applying a driveway sealant can create a barrier against moss growth.
  • Regular Cleaning: Keep the driveway clean and free from debris that can retain moisture.

Implementing these measures will help maintain a moss-free driveway and extend the lifespan of your pavement.

Additionally, consider periodic inspections to catch any signs of moss early before they become a major problem.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How often should I remove moss from my driveway in Sidcup?

It is recommended to inspect your driveway for moss at least twice a year and perform removal as needed, especially during damp seasons.

2. Can I use household cleaning products to remove moss?

Yes, natural remedies like vinegar or baking soda can be effective for light moss growth. However, for severe infestations, specialized treatments may be necessary.

3. Is moss removal harmful to the environment?

When using chemical treatments, it's important to choose environmentally friendly options to minimize any negative impact. Professionals can help ensure safe and effective removal.

4. How can I prevent moss from returning to my driveway?

Improve drainage, increase sunlight exposure, use sealants, and maintain regular cleaning to prevent moss from reappearing.

5. When is the best time of year to remove moss from my driveway?

The best times to remove moss are during the spring and autumn when conditions are optimal for effective treatment and prevention.
